What do i do when the doctor gives me bad news?
Coping with Bad News from the Doctor
When the doctor gives you bad news, it can be a challenging and emotional experience. You may feel overwhelmed, scared, or even hopeless. However, as a Christian, you can find comfort and strength in God's presence and promises. The Bible teaches us to bring our concerns and fears to God in prayer, asking for His guidance, wisdom, and healing. When facing a medical crisis, it's essential to remember that God is sovereign and in control, even when we don't understand what's happening.
In times of uncertainty, it's natural to feel like there's nothing we can do to change the outcome. However, the Bible encourages us to trust in God's goodness and sovereignty, even when we can't see a way forward. Psalm 121:1-2 says, "I lift up my eyes to the mountains—where does my help come from? My help comes from the Lord, the Maker of heaven and earth." We can trust that God is working all things together for our good, even in the midst of bad news (Romans 8:28). As we pray and seek God's guidance, we can find peace and hope in His presence.
In the face of bad news, it's crucial to remember that God is our Healer, and He can work in ways we don't expect. We can pray for healing, but we must also trust in God's sovereignty and goodness, even if the outcome is not what we desire. As we navigate the challenges of a medical crisis, we can find comfort in God's presence, promises, and power. We can pray for wisdom, guidance, and healing, and trust that God is working all things together for our good. Ultimately, our hope is not in our own abilities or circumstances but in the goodness and sovereignty of our loving God.
